Repairing a cracked windowpane
When you find a cracked window, it's important to take a look at the possibilities. You can avoid spending much by hiring a professional to fix the damaged glass.
The costs of repairing damaged windows can differ dependent on the size, style and type of the window. Some specialty hardware may also increase the price.
A window that is cracked can be repaired with an epoxy mixture. It is a thermosetting plastic. This process involves cleaning the inside of the window, filling the crack with epoxy and letting it cure.
A broken window could be a real hassle. Broken windows can cause damage to your home and can reduce the efficiency of your energy. If the glass is damaged in a double pane window, it can create drafts.
Depending on the thickness of your window the cost to repair damaged glass could range from $70 to as high as $300. The final cost will depend on the kind of glass, its frame and the size crack.
Double-pane windows are vital in insulating your home. They also ensure that your cooling and heating systems function efficiently. If the window is broken it could impact the energy efficiency of your HVAC system, resulting in a higher cost for energy.
Cracked window panes can occur due to a variety of reasons. Weather conditions, poor insulation, and broken glass are all possible causes. To determine the reason for cracks in your window, you should seek out a professional for a thorough inspection.
Resealing a double-paned windows
If you notice fogging, condensation, or clouding on your double-pane window, you will need to seal it. While it won't restore the energy efficiency of your window but it can extend its lifespan.
The sealing of windows should be carried out on a regular basis. Temperature extremes can cause cracking or failure of double-pane windows.
Window seal failure could be caused by poor installation, aging, or extreme temperature fluctuations. This can cause the sealant to crack, which lets moisture into the air pocket.
A dehumidifier is one the most efficient methods of getting rid of moisture from double-pane windows double glazing. A defogging kit can be purchased to help you do it yourself.
Re-sealing a double glazed units-pane glass is not an easy project. It requires cleaning the inside of your glass and re-installing the sealant. The work can be done by yourself or by an expert.
First, you'll need to clean the frame of the window. This involves taking off the sealant that was used and the trim. This can be accomplished with scraper and a small tool with a hammer.
Next, you need to drill holes in the glass. You should do this about two inches from the corner. To create the hole, you will need a special bit. Make sure you drill deep enough to allow for the inserting of thin objects.
After you've made the holes, it is now time to insert the desiccant packet. Desiccant is a material that absorbs moisture. A desiccant is only temporary.

Repairing a single-pane glass window
The cost of repairing the single-pane glass window is contingent on a variety of factors. The cost of fixing one-pane glass windows is contingent on the type, size, and thickness. If the glass breaks and requires replacement A professional will take it and replace it with a new one.
The average cost to replace windows ranges from $100-$200, Double Glazing Near Me however costs vary based upon the size and design of the windows. Larger windows that are heavier and more expensive.
Single-pane glass is often used in older homes. They are less difficult to repair , but are less energy efficient. Double-pane glass is a better option. It is able to block out sound and improve energy efficiency.
Double-paned windows need additional work and materials. Depending on the complexity of the glass, the price could range from $200 to $400. It may also be necessary to upgrade the insulation in the frames.
Older wooden windows typically require more extensive repairs. You can fix the window yourself or employ a glazier. The hourly rate of a glazier is usually between $50 to $80.
If you decide to hire a glazier to get three quotes. A company with a great reputation is a wise choice. Review sites are a good starting point.
